New-Generation Hyundai Creta Might Launch In February 2020 – Report
2020 Hyundai Creta will rival on the upcoming Kia Seltos.
The South Korean carmaker that entered into sub-compact SUV space with the all-new Hyundai Venue, will soon give a generation change to its highest-selling SUV – Hyundai Creta. According to a latest media report, the next-generation Creta will debut at the Delhi Auto Expo in February, 2020, followed by its launch. In the premium compact SUV segment, the 2020 Hyundai Creta will take on the upcoming Kia Seltos that will have its India debut on coming 20th June.
Design changes that will be made to the 2020 Hyundai Creta are likely to be inspired by the China-spec Hyundai ix25. The latest spy pictures reveal that the SUV new-generation model will witness comprehensive styling updates along with significant dimensional changes. Some of its key changes might include a new grille, re-designed headlamps with LED DRLs, revised bumpers and new LED taillamps. Read: 2020 Hyundai Creta – 5 Big Expected Changes

Interestingly, the new Creta will come with 5-seats and 7-seats layouts. Its overall length and width will be increased along with the significantly stretched wheelbase. Interior could also be upgraded with a set of advanced connectivity features including Hyundai’s Blue Link technology, internet-based features (similar to the Venue) and a large 10.25-inch touchscreen infotainment system. As far as engines are concerned, the 2020 Hyundai Creta could be offered with a new BS6-ready 1.5L petrol and diesel powertrains. Both engines will debut on the Kia Seltos. Transmission choices will include manual and automatic units.
